05EC261 on DUSLPA

EC261 applies because DUS is a EU airport

Your departure airport (DUS, Düsseldorf) is in Germany. EC261 covers all flights departing EU airports, regardless of airline nationality or destination. The fact that your destination (LPA, Las Palmas) is in Spain does not change the applicable regulation.

Why is DUS–LPA compensation €600?

The route is 3,620 km, exceeding the 3,500 km threshold for tier 3 compensation under EC261.
